Job Description
About Hightouch
Hightouch’s mission is to empower everyone to take action on their data. Through our Reverse ETL platform, business and data users can seamlessly sync data from where it resides, such as warehouses and databases, to where it is needed, including operational systems and SaaS tools. Traditionally, acting on data has required engineering time and bandwidth, and left most business users stuck with charts and reports that are unable to take automated action on their data. With Hightouch, every business user, without writing any code, can activate data to streamline critical processes, improve marketing performance, and scale operations.
Our team operates with a focus on making a meaningful impact for our customers. We believe in approaching challenges with a first principles thinking mindset, moving quickly and embracing our value of efficient execution, and treating each other with compassion and kindness. We look for team members that are strong communicators, have a growth mindset, and are motivated and persistent in achieving our goals.
Hundreds of companies use Hightouch, including Spotify, Ramp, Retool, NBA, Plaid, and Betterment. We’re based in San Francisco, are remote-friendly, and backed by leading investors such as Amplify Partners, ICONIQ Growth, Bain Capital Ventures, Y-Combinator, and Afore Capital.
About the Role
We are looking for a backend engineer to join our Platform team and own our destination integrations.
In this role, you will build and improve the destinations that move customer data from warehouses to hundreds of SaaS tools.
This is an opportunity to ship code daily that solves real problems for users. On this small team, each engineer plays an important role in expanding our destination catalog to fuel the next phase of Hightouch's growth.
Your responsibilities will include:
- Working with a wide variety of APIs
- Developing new destination features and integrations based on customer needs
- Working cross-functionally with other teams in engineering, product, design, customer success, and sales
- Debugging and improving existing destinations through code reviews and customer support tickets
- Helping guide technical direction and priorities for destinations and UX
- Communicating with customers and coworkers to understand requirements and explain solutions
- Writing code that is scalable, maintainable, and meets our high bar for quality
We are looking for engineers who are eager to ship quickly, take ownership of their work, and learn new things every day. This role requires both strong technical skills and great communication abilities.
We are looking for talented, intellectually curious, and motivated individuals who are interested in tackling the problems above. The salary range for this position is $110,000 - $150,000 USD per year, which is location independent in accordance with our remote-first policy.
Interview Process
Our interview process focuses on evaluating fit for the most important dimensions of the role: product sense, ability to understand customer use cases and needs, and competency implementing solutions with different APIs.
- Intro Call [15-30m]: Introductory call with either a member of our recruiting team or the hiring manager to get to know each other and see if the role could be a good mutual fit.
- Take-Home Coding Exercise [3-4h]: Implement a basic version of a Hightouch destination to see what it’s like to work on reverse ETL.
- Product Interview [90m]: Consider customer use cases live and translate them into technical decisions.
- Technical Project Interview [60m]: Work with the interviewer to deep-dive on a complex integration problem and design a solution based on customer and technical requirements.
- Hiring Manager Interview [30m]: Chat with hiring manager about past experiences and future operating preferences to assess fit on company values and operating principles.
Explore More
Date Posted
11/06/2023
Views
0
Similar Jobs
Software Engineer Networking Software and Services - xAI
Views in the last 30 days - 0
The text describes xAIs mission to develop AI systems for understanding the universe and advancing human knowledge It outlines a role involving networ...
View DetailsAssociate Technical Support Engineer - Recharge
Views in the last 30 days - 0
Recharge is a subscription platform for innovative brands offering customer retention solutions They seek Technical Support roles with 247 coverage em...
View DetailsFull Stack Product Engineer - Jiga
Views in the last 30 days - 0
Jiga is a remotefriendly company focused on empowering engineers with trust autonomy and flexibility They emphasize simplicity ownership and impactful...
View DetailsSenior Design Manager (Infrastructure) - Canonical
Views in the last 30 days - 0
Canonical a leading opensource provider seeks a Senior Design Manager to drive innovation in cloud and AI technologies The role offers remote work glo...
View DetailsSenior Product Designer - Org & Security - Typeform
Views in the last 30 days - 0
This job description outlines a role in developing an intelligent contact management system with AI capabilities The position involves designing user ...
View DetailsExecutive Director Patient Advocacy - Kyverna Therapeutics
Views in the last 30 days - 0
Kyverna Therapeutics is seeking an Executive Director for Patient Advocacy to lead initiatives in autoimmune disease treatment The role involves build...
View Details